Measuring Inclusion, Similarity And Compatibility Between Atanassov'S Intuitionistic Fuzzy Sets
Abstract
This paper establishes an axiomatic definition of inclusion measures between Atanassov's intuitionistic fuzzy (A-IF for short) sets. Some kinds of A-IF inclusion measures are constructed by different A-IF operators especially by A-IF implicator, and some new methods for measuring the degree of similarity between A-IF sets are proposed. Moreover, the similarity measure obtained from an A-IF inclusion measure satisfies properties of normal similarity measure. We then define a compatibility measure by a predicates logical idea and construct several functions to measure compatibility for an intuitionistic t-norm.
